Indexes education-related literature, beginning in 1966. It is the worlds largest source of education information, containing abstracts of documents and journal articles on education research and practice. ERIC covers descriptions and evaluations of programs, research reports and surveys, curriculum and teaching guides, instructional materials, position papers, and resource materials. In 1993, it began indexing education-related books, including the output of major publishers.

Try pairing distinct concepts together like the examples shown below.
“gran torino” AND masculinity
“gran torino” AND “white savior”
“joy luck club” AND identity
“joy luck club” AND motherhood
“joy luck club” AND race
“joy luck club” AND feminism
Adding quotation marks around a phrase "tells" the database/search engine to find results with that exact phrase.
